2nd Step - Application for Registration with the CVBC
Please note that any reference to the BCVMA in the attached documents is deemed to be a reference to the CVBC.
Comprehensive information and forms for all applicants.
Please note that generally new applicants to Canada must have a Certificate of Qualifications from the National Examining Board (NEB) before they are eligible to apply for membership in the CVBC.
The NEB is administered by the Canadian Veterinary Medical Association (CVMA). Please see www.canadianveterinarians.net and the links below for further information on this prerequisite.
Please note that all documents that are submitted during the Registration process must be current, original or notarized copies.
